Description
The solar sensor, which is installed on the upper side of the instrument panel, detects sunlight and controls the air conditioning auto mode. The output voltage from the solar sensor varies in accordance with the amount of sunlight. When the sunlight increases, the output voltage increases. As the sunlight decreases, the output voltage decreases.
The air conditioning amplifier detects changes in the output voltage from the solar sensor.
